This review is for Mamak, Melbourne VIC

verified email - 19 Dec 2012

Overrated.
A group of 8 of us ate here so we had a wide variety of dishes. None were stand out, none were bad, they were all mediocre. Opinion is harsher due to high expectations BUT I have had nicer Malaysian food in the “suburbs”. The roti which is meant to be “amazing”, was ordinary, again, have had much better.

The service was non-existent and when they did come to us, obliging but not very friendly. Prices were reasonable for the dishes, with the exception of the roti dishes, way over priced.
Décor is nice but it is a very noisy restaurant. We had a baby crying at a table about 10m from us for most of the night, we hardly heard it though due to all the other noise.

I would not go back and would not recommend. Yes I have been to Malaysia, yes I have eaten Malaysian many times.

This review is for Kinderballet, Essendon VIC

verified email - 12 Dec 2012

My 3 year old daughter attended the Greensborough location for a term. I found that the teacher lacked warmth and rarely interacted with the girls (outside of her "instructing") and it was unusual for her to interact with the parents.
The quality of what they were doing was poor. It was more imagination play rather than actually showing them how to do x or y properly. I appreciate at this age they are limited but there are things they can do and should be shown how to do it correctly. For the price I expect a lot more to come out of it.
By the end of the term my daughter was bored of it, they did the same thing every week and didn't learn a lot.
